Output 1320cd2edd8fac308dbbfffeebb846a772cdc3b0aa0a9f0e4e9158ca210b0eda:1

value
8624532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ff54d166e13f25a93150549f16beeffeddcd2cba OP_EQUAL
address
3Qy5qiXaj89Ns5PuVZpzBDsmw38kcaLCGH
transaction
1320cd2edd8fac308dbbfffeebb846a772cdc3b0aa0a9f0e4e9158ca210b0eda
confirmations
405369
spent
true